Where is the Hillbish family from?

You can see how Hillbish families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Hillbish family name was found in the USA between 1880 and 1920. The most Hillbish families were found in US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 19 Hillbish families living in Pennsylvania. This was about 83% of all the recorded Hillbish's in USA. Pennsylvania had the highest population of Hillbish families in 1880.
